Hello im not sure if this is the right place to post this but it dose contain a networking portion to it that may be important.

Basically I'm trying to share a hp psc 1215 printer on my windows xp machine with my windows 7 machine.

The printer uses usb and is plugged in to the xp machine which is connected to a router my 7 machine connects to it witlessly and so far the 7 machine can use it and send print jobs to it. But the problem i encounter is i cant access the printer preferences and so can not change paper size or any other features from my 7 machine. Every time i go to open them from the device and printer panel the window appears and then goes again. Can anyone help me find a solution.

Hi and welcome

Sometimes a priter has to be ainstalled locally to install all the driver before it can be successfully shared. So if you install it to the win 7 machine and then put it back on the xp machine it might work


Goord luck and let us know if it doesnt fix it
